I must agree with the last poster. When the old management team was at this place, I loved living there. When the new people came in, they continually closed the office for one reason or another. They closed it to take inventory one day. Dang, thats a lot of paper clips to count to close for 8 hours. On this particular day, I had a leak in my apartment coming from the unit above. I attempted to call the office to let them know of it, and all I got was a recording. I had a true emergency and they didn't even bother answering the phone. I too had problems with my neighbors below with loud music. In broad day light their music was so loud it shook my apartment. I called the office and was told to call the police. I am single and live alone, now why would I want to do that when there are several men below me that could possibly find out I called the cops. I told the office that THEY were the MANAGEMENT, and it was their responsibility to take care of this. The smart mouthed little twit told me that I pay taxes so the cops can take care of it. I told the bald little smart mouthed snot that I PAID RENT FOR HIM TO TAKE CARE OF IT. I too called "Naomi the ----" and she was of no help. Normally I am a very patient person, but it ran very thin with this new company. With the old company, if you were caught not picking up after your dog you were fined for it. With these new people they could care less if these people let their dogs go boom boom all over the place. My neighbors kid stepped in a big load that looked like it came from a horse rather than a dog. They did paint our hallways and patio's. I was not informed that the patios were to be painted and they entered my apartment WITHOUT permission and took all the things in from my patio. A spider built a web under my patio furniture and got into my apartment plus the painters just threw my patio set ON TOP OF MY WHITE LIVING ROOM SOFA! HELLO! Patio furniture is DIRTY and now is my sofa and my carpeting as well. Ont the day they painted the hallways, they had the whole building blocked off. It was hot as crap out and I came in from work and had to go out for a few hours so that the paint could dry. This was totally inconveient for me. The kids at this place run wild. Parents don't care. In my building there was a girl about 15 years old that was "home schooled" she had the mouth of a sailor, and I went down to the pool one night for a swim since it was not crowded and saw this chick and hey boyfriend having SEX in the pool. I didn't touch the pool after. I understand that the chemicals in the pool would kill any diseases but the fact remains that these kids were allowed to procreate in a public pool. I left before my lease term was over because of the piss poor management at this place. Pat if you are reading this I want to live where u are now.
